Anna McDonald is a writer from Gainesville, Georgia, who lives in New York City, and teaches in the Expository Writing Program at NYU.
Her work has been published in Food & Wine, Readymade, CITY, Atlanta, The New York Post, The Virginia Quarterly Review, Cap Gun, and Mr. Beller's Neighborhood. She has work forthcoming in Saveur and The Paris Review.
She holds an MFA in Poetry from New York University. She holds a B.A. in English from the University of Virginia.
